To make my kitchen Buddha smile I created a delicious purple smoothie that is not only good for the body, but also wonderful for the soul. As always, this recipe is here to inspire your own creativity. You may want to use different ingredients or the same ingredient in different proportions. Experiment and have fun with it.


Ingredients:
  • 2 cups fresh or frozen blueberries
  • 1 cup fresh or frozen blackberries
  • 1 scoop powdered supergreens
  • 1 scoop açai powder
  • 1 scoop raw protein (optional)
  • 1 cup almond milk
  • 2-3 ice cubes if you are using fresh berries
Method:
  • Place berries in blender. Add 1/2 cup of almond milk and process until berries are crushed.
  • Add supergreens and açai. Blend again. 
  • Add protein powder and the remaining almond milk. Blend until smooth. Enjoy in good company.
